How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Northridge?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Northridge Studio Apartments | $1,811 | $1,175 | $2,405 |
| Northridge 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,219 | $1,040 | $5,160 |
| Northridge 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,884 | $1,180 | $8,732 |
| Northridge 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,909 | $2,625 | $10,000+ |
| Northridge 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,412 | $1,585 | $3,762 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Gated Northridge Apartments
What is the Cheapest Gated apartment in Northridge?
Currently the most affordable Gated Apartment in Northridge is at Devon Heights listed at $1,195.
How much is the average rent for a Gated Northridge Apartment?
The average rent for a Gated Apartment in Northridge is $2,231.
What is the largest Gated Northridge Apartment for rent?
Today's Gated apartment with the most square footage in Northridge is a 1,529 square feet unit starting from $1,824 at The Esplanade.
What is the average size for Northridge Gated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Gated rental in Northridge is currently at 663 sq ft.
